In his thought-provoking piece “Unimpeachable AI Guardrails”, Zach Meyers explores the ethical challenges AI introduces to the valuation profession. Using the metaphor of a literal guardrail (and a real-life car crash), he emphasizes the importance of principle-based standards over mere checkbox compliance. 

Meyers argues for transparency in AI use, but warns that disclosure alone is not enough — human judgment, accountability, and proper training remain essential. His article outlines potential “guardrails” for AI in valuation, from mandatory disclosure to prohibiting sole reliance on AI, and calls for the profession to reaffirm its core values in the age of automation.
